What does hurt mean?

noun

  1. An emotional or psychological humiliation or bad experience.

    how to overcome old hurts of the past

  2. A bodily injury causing pain; a wound or bruise.

verb

  1. To be painful.

    Does your leg still hurt? / It is starting to feel better.

  2. To cause (a creature) physical pain and/or injury.

    If anybody hurts my little brother, I will get upset.

adjective

  1. Wounded, physically injured.
  2. Pained.
